Redmond is a city located in King County, Washington, United States. It is known as the home of Microsoft Corporation, one of the world's largest technology companies. The city has a rich history dating back to the late 1800s when it was primarily a logging and farming community. In the early 1900s, Redmond became a major transportation hub with the arrival of the Great Northern Railway, which brought freight and passengers to the area. Halifax, Nova Scotia, is a historic city known for its deep connection to the sea. As a major port city, Halifax has played a significant role in maritime trade and transportation for centuries. The city's strategic location on the eastern coast of Canada has made it a hub for freight transportation, with a bustling port that handles a wide range of goods and commodities. Halifax's port is one of the busiest in Canada, serving as a key gateway for trade between North America and Europe.
One of the most famous events in Halifax's history is the Halifax Explosion of 1917, when a collision in the harbor resulted in a catastrophic explosion that devastated the city. The explosion, which was the largest man-made blast prior to the development of nuclear weapons, had a profound impact on Halifax's infrastructure and economy. Despite the destruction, Halifax quickly rebuilt and continued to grow as a vital center for shipping and transportation.
